In 1999, Pakistan’s army, led by General Musharraf, infiltrated Kargil, aiming to sever India’s vital National Highway-1A and seize the Siachen Glacier. Local shepherds alerted the Indian Army, which initially mistook intruders for terrorists. After a patrol led by Lt. Saurabh Kalia was captured and brutally killed, the full scale of the incursion became clear.
